Course description

DJ/ Producer Certificate:

Scott Smart of Brodanse told us: "These days you must be a successful producer to get DJ gigs" and we agree with him. Virtually everyone in Resident Advisor’s Top 100 DJ poll release their own productions and this certificate course enables you to do the same. You get to take advantage of the fantastic facilities in the Pioneer DJ Studio featuring the latest Pioneer kit while taking 4 modules with 2 lecture days per week. You also get unlimited practice time outside of lecture days. This is a great course if you want to focus on your music and DJing and improve your creative skillset using Ableton Live or Logic Pro. Taught by Ableton Certified Trainers and Logic experts who have released on labels such as One Inch Punch, Bad Sekta and Frogs and worked with Wu Tang, Estelle, Omar and Sway - see Expert Instructors below - this course is suitable for beginners and experienced users alike. As well as being a well-establlished Authorized Apple Training Centre, Point Blank is proud to offer its students the best equipped Ableton Live facility in the world including 17 sought after Push controllers, one for each student.

Suitability - Who should attend?

1. Edexcel Qualification Option: This Point Blank course is accredited by Edexcel. Therefore, if you wish to opt in for this accreditation and have a chance of gaining the BTEC qualification associated with this course, you will need to provide evidence of at least one item from the following list: a) 4 GCSE passes at A* - C (music and English preferred) or equivalent b) BTEC Level 2 Diploma or equivalent c) Relevant experience d) Exceptional ability An interest in sound recording and computer music is relevant. 2. Non-Accredited Option: If you do not wish to participate in the Edexcel accreditation and wish instead to concentrate on the practical, non-academic side of your Point Blank course, you can take this course without any prior experience. It is creative and practical in nature so academic grades are not required to enrol. Point Blank ensures that students have a sound grasp of all the fundamental music production skills before moving on to more complex techniques in later course modules.
